I Never Want To See You Again As Nicole’s body submerged in the biting cold water, she felt the chill penetrate every inch of her being.
She couldn't stop her body from shivering.
Her limbs suffered severe cramps and numbness.
But she couldn’t waste even a single second.
The water had washed away the blood on her forehead.
Those voracious piranhas had already smelled it, and they quickly swam toward her.
Nicole bit the tip of her tongue, hoping to dispel the numbness.
She didn't stop, even if she had already tasted blood in her mouth.
Then, she quickly swam toward the yacht.
At this moment, a life-saving rope was lowered from the yacht.
Jarrod knew Nicole was good at swimming.
As long as she grabbed the rope, she would surely be safe.
But so what if she made it back to the yacht safely? At this moment, he already despised her to the core.
Even if she miraculously survived, he would definitely continue tormenting her until her life became a living hell.
Jamie still stood on the deck, wanting to watch the fun.
But when Jarrod turned around and saw her, he said concernedly in a warm voice, "Why don't you go inside? You may catch a cold if you stay here longer.” Jamie held Jarrod's arm and said coquettishly, "Look at you.
Your clothes are still wet.
Go inside and get changed.
I want you to accompany me.” Suddenly, the crowd behind them burst into an uproar.
Someone shouted, “She got bitten!" These three words made Jarrod's fingers tighten, and his brows furrowed deeply.
He instantly brushed off Jamie's hand and rushed to the railing to check.
Jamie watched Jarrod's back with hatred.
The tenderness and affection in her eyes were replaced by malice.
She thought it would be better if Nicole died.
That bitch gave her nothing but trouble.
Jamie deliberately said those words to Jarrod, thinking someone as prideful as him would strangle Nicole to death.
But to her dismay, what she did didn't even sever their emotional connection.
She stomped her feet in annoyance and followed Jarrod to the railing to see what was going on.
Since she fell in the water just now, she knew the water was bone-chilling.
